Poor Navigation Structure and User Flow

A good navigation structure and user flow are key for e-commerce sites and content management systems. Users who find what they need easily are more likely to stay and buy. Clear navigation can make the site easier to use and boost sales.

When designing navigation, think about simplicityconsistency, and visibility. A simple structure with few options helps users find what they need fast. Keeping navigation consistent helps users know how to use the site. It’s also crucial for navigation to be easy to see so users know where they are and where they can go.

Here are some tips for a user-friendly navigation and flow:

  • Use clear and concise language in navigation labels
  • Use breadcrumbs to help users understand their location on the site
  • Use a consistent layout throughout the site

By following these tips, e-commerce sites and content management systems can make their navigation easy. This leads to a better user experience and more sales.

Accessibility Oversights in Modern Web Design

Making a website accessible to all is key for a good user experience. This means looking at things like content management systems. It ensures everyone can use the site, no matter their abilities. If we overlook accessibility, we might lose users and money.

When making a website, we must follow WCAG guidelines. These help make web content accessible. It’s essential to ensure the site works well with screen readers for the blind. Also, the colours used must be easy to read.

WCAG Compliance Basics

WCAG compliance means following rules to make web content accessible. This includes adding text for images, making the site work with a keyboard, and adding video captions. By doing this, we ensure everyone can use the site, regardless of their abilities.

Screen Reader Compatibility

For people who can’t see, using screen readers is crucial. We must ensure our website works with popular screen readers like JAWS and NVDA. This means adding text for images, making navigation easy with a keyboard, and adding video captions.

Colour Contrast Considerations

Choosing the right colours is essential for readability. We need to make sure the text stands out against the background. This is especially true for people with vision problems who struggle with low contrast.

Typography and Readability Issues

Typography and readability are key in website design. A good website should be easy to read and navigate. Typography is often ignored in web development, but it’s crucial for a good user experience.

Good typography makes a website easy to read. Lousy typography can lead to people leaving quickly. To improve readability, follow font size and spacing rules. The font should be big enough to read but not too big.

Font Size and Spacing Guidelines

Here are some guidelines for font size and spacing:

  • Use a font size between 12 and 18 pixels for body text.
  • Use a line height of at least 1.5 times the font size.
  • Use a margin of at least 10 pixels between paragraphs.

Colour Combinations for Text

Colour combinations also matter for readability. Choose colours that contrast nicely with the background. Aim for a contrast ratio of at least 4.5:1. Use dark text on light backgrounds or light text on dark backgrounds.

In conclusion, typography and readability are vital in website design and development. Following guidelines for font size, spacing, and colour, you can make your website easy to read and use.

SEO-Unfriendly Design Elements

Building a website that search engines like means paying attention to design details. A responsive design is key for being seen on all devices. Also, good SEO is vital for showing up in search results.

Design flaws like bad image alt text, wrong URL structure, and poor meta tags can hurt your site’s ranking. These errors make it challenging for people to find your website.

Image Alt Text Mistakes

Image alt text is crucial for SEO. It describes images for search engines and users who can’t see them. Common errors include missing alt text, using vague descriptions, or not adding relevant keywords.

URL Structure Problems

A good URL structure is key for SEO. It should be clear, short, and include important keywords. A bad URL structure confuses search engines and hurts your ranking.

Meta Tag Optimization

Meta tags give search engines vital info about your page, like title, description, and keywords. Optimizing them can boost your ranking and visibility. A responsive design and good SEO ensure your site is friendly to users and search engines.
